Introduced 01/25/06, by Rep. Kathleen A. Ryg

 

SYNOPSIS AS INTRODUCED:
 
55 ILCS 5/5-15023 new

    Amends the Counties Code. Allows any county board of health to declare a water emergency and to regulate well use in the areas affected by the water emergency. Effective immediately.

1     AN ACT concerning local government.
 
2     Be it enacted by the People of the State of Illinois,
3 represented in the General Assembly:
 
4     Section 5. The Counties Code is amended by adding Section
5 5-15023 as follows:
 
6     (55 ILCS 5/5-15023 new)
7     Sec. 5-15023. Water emergencies; well use. A county board
8 of health may declare a water emergency within the county. If a
9 board of health declares a water emergency under this Section,
10 it may regulate well use within the area affected by the water
11 emergency. For the purposes of this Section, "water emergency"
12 means a critical event or series of events that disrupts the
13 availability of clean drinking water, including, but not
14 limited to, drought, overuse, and contamination of the water
15 supply. The county shall have the power to enforce any
16 regulations adopted under this Section.
 
17     Section 99. Effective date. This Act takes effect upon
18 becoming law.
